David is joined this week by David Malpass, immediate past president of the World Bank, and long-time distinguished economist through multiple presidential administrations. They discuss the role of excessive government debt in impeding developed and developing nation’s growth, the underrated need for a strong and stable currency, and the lessons learned out of his extensive public- and private-sector service when it comes to optimal conditions for economic growth.
